#FAAD28 Hex Color Code

#FAAD28

The Hexadecimal Color #FAAD28 is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#FAAD28 RGB value is rgb(250, 173, 40). RGB Color Model of #FAAD28 consists of 98% red, 67% green and 15% blue. HSL color Mode of #FAAD28 has 38°(degrees) Hue, 95% Saturation and 57% Lightness. #FAAD28 color has an wavelength of 596.07407n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FAAD28 is #FFC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FAAD28 is #FA2. The Closest Color to #FAAD28 is #DAA520. Official Name of #FAAD28 Hex Code is Sea Buckthorn.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FAAD28 is 0 Cyan 31 Magenta 84 Yellow 2 Black and #FAAD28 CMY is 0, 31, 84.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FAAD28 is hsl(38,95,57,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(38, 84,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FAAD28 is 54.76, 50.37, 8.85.
Hex8 Value of #FAAD28 is #FAAD28FF. Decimal Value of #FAAD28 is 16428328 and Octal Value of #FAAD28 is 76526450. Binary Value of #FAAD28 is 11111010, 10101101, 101000 and Android of #FAAD28 is 4294618408 / 0xfffaad28.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FAAD28 is 0.48, 0.442, 0.442 and YIQ Color Space of #FAAD28 is 180.861, 88.6172, -25.1041.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FAAD28 is 60.33, 47.03, 9.55.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FAAD28 is 76.3, 18.22, 72.5.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FAAD28 is 76.3, 63.38, 72.75.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FAAD28 is 76.3, 74.75, 75.89. Hunter Lab variable of #FAAD28 is 70.97, 13.53, 42.29.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FAAD28

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
